Sustenabilitate in productia CNC
Hartford a integrat in sistemele sale de control CNC doua tehnologii complementare de economisire a energiei: Energy Monitoring si Eco Mode. Impreuna, pot reduce consumul energetic total cu pana la 40% fata de operarea conventionala.
Energy Monitoring — vizibilitate completa a consumului
- Monitorizare in timp real a consumului tuturor componentelor masinii
- Colectare de date istorice si functionalitate de raportare
- Urmarirea emisiilor de CO² alaturi de calculul costurilor cu energia electrica
- Grafice vizuale care afiseaza tipare de utilizare a energiei
- Detectare personalizata a componentelor in functie de modelul specific al masinii
Eco Mode — management inteligent al echipamentelor periferice
Functia Eco Mode gestioneaza operarea echipamentelor periferice in timpul prelucrarii si in perioadele de asteptare: motoare hidraulice, racitoare de ulei, colectoare de ceata de ulei, iluminatul de lucru si transportoare de achii.
In loc sa controleze manual fiecare dispozitiv periferic, operatorul activeaza Eco Mode pentru a reduce sistematic consumul energetic pe toate sistemele auxiliare simultan.
Obiectivul de economisire: 40%
Implementarea corecta poate livra o reducere de aproximativ 40% in consumul energetic total, provenind din:
- Optimizarea regimurilor de functionare ale echipamentelor periferice
- Eliminarea consumului inutil in perioadele de inactivitate
- Adaptarea automata a parametrilor de racire la conditiile reale de prelucrare

Sustainability in CNC Production
Hartford has integrated two complementary energy-saving technologies into its CNC control systems: Energy Monitoring and Eco Mode. Together, they can reduce total energy consumption by up to 40% compared to conventional operation.
Energy Monitoring — Complete Consumption Visibility
- Real-time consumption monitoring of all machine components
- Historical data collection and reporting functionality
- CO² emission tracking alongside electricity cost calculations
- Visual charts displaying energy usage patterns
- Customized component detection based on the specific machine model
Eco Mode — Intelligent Peripheral Equipment Management
Eco Mode manages peripheral equipment operation during both active machining and idle periods: hydraulic motors, oil coolers, oil mist collectors, work lighting and chip conveyors.
Instead of manually controlling each peripheral device, the operator activates Eco Mode to systematically reduce energy consumption across all auxiliary systems simultaneously.
The 40% Savings Target
Correct implementation can deliver approximately 40% reduction in total energy consumption from:
- Optimization of peripheral equipment operating regimes
- Elimination of unnecessary consumption during idle periods
- Automatic adaptation of cooling parameters to actual machining conditions
